Flash ROM Programming
The American Megatrends Atlas PCI Pentium motherboard uses Flash EPROM to store the system BIOS.
The advantage of using a Flash EPROM is that the EPROM chip does not have to be replaced to update the
BIOS. The end user can actually reprogram the BIOS, using a ROM file supplied by American Megatrends.
There are three methods for programming the Flash EPROM:
program from system boot,

set U86 switch 2 ON, or

run the AMIFlash utility.
Programming Flash from System Boot
Using the floppy disk with the new BIOS file, press and hold down the <Home> key to reprogram the Atlas
PCI Pentium motherboard Flash EPROM-based WinBIOS before DOS boots.
Using AMIFlash
AMIFlash is a DOS utility that is executed from the DOS command line. You can reprogram the Atlas PCI
Pentium motherboard Flash EPROM-based WinBIOS from the DOS command prompt using AMIFlash.
Set U86 Switch 2
Insert the floppy disk with the new BIOS in floppy drive A:. Set U86 switch 2 ON to program the Flash
EPROM.
